Whether you are buying or renovating a home, here is a quick reference guide to see if items have been approved by the county. Check on a previous permit to see if it's been fully approved and completed or if it's an open case.
Reasons why you may need a permit, to get a(an):
- Addition
- Basement-existing
- Deck
- Driveway (apron only)
- Electrical Work
- Exterior Work on Historic Property
- Fence
- Fire Repair
- Garage
- Hot tub
- HVAC/Heating (replacing)
- Interior Alteration
- Retaining Wall
- Replacing structural members of roof framing, including sheathing
- Solar Panels
- Shed
- Signs
- Sunroom
- Swimming Pool
- A wood burning stove/fireplace installation
- Change the size of doors and windows or make new openings for same
- Change a building's use
- Structural alterations
